Cresaptown, MD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Cresaptown?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cresaptown 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,212 | $850 | $2,095 |
| Cresaptown 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,989 | $850 | $3,700 |
| Cresaptown 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,533 | $3,200 | $3,900 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cresaptown
What type of rentals are currently available in Cresaptown?
There are currently 53 Apartments for Rent in Cresaptown, MD with pricing that ranges from $500 to $3,900. There are also 35 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Cresaptown ranging from $575 to $3,900.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Cresaptown?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Cresaptown ranges from $575 to $3,900 with an average monthly rent of $1,708.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Cresaptown?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Cresaptown range from $840 to $3,348,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$850 to $3,700.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,200 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$3,900.
